Transaction dff04a6c5142d4d391152cf8896a8f1750c13b2563a38cdc8e5d3a45aafdde43

28 Input
1 Outputs
  • dff04a6c5142d4d391152cf8896a8f1750c13b2563a38cdc8e5d3a45aafdde43:0
  • value  3256507
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G